ActionScript 3 Air Desktop Application Browse For Local Directory Popup

Hello all,

 

I am developing a desktop Air program that will include a browse button that allows the user to click, and once the user clicks the button, I am wanting a pop-up window to appear that allows the user to browse to a writable folder/directory on his computer. Once the user selects a folder in the window, I want to grab that directory location and store it. The storing part I know how to do, but how to create this pop-up window or dialog, I do not have a clue where to start.

 

What's the simplest way to go about this?

 

Edit:

I see I can use this example from this site, but I don't know where to grab the directory the user selected: actionscript 3 - How to create "Browse for folder" dialog in Adobe FLEX? - Stack Overflow

var f :File=newFile;
f
.addEventListener(Event.SELECT, onFolderSelected);
f
.browseForDirectory("Choose a directory");
